Abstract:
Provided are a humidity control member capable of adsorbing and desorbing a large amount of moisture, and a method for manufacturing the humidity control member. A humidity control member containing a carrier and a silica porous body having an average pore diameter of 1 nm or above, wherein the humidity control member has an alkali metal element content of 0.001 wt% to less than 1.0 wt%. A method for manufacturing a humidity control member including steps (1), (2), and (3). Step (1): A dispersion medium and a silica porous body having an average pore diameter of 1 nm or above are mixed, and a slurry is obtained. The alkali metal element content, relative to the solid weight, of the slurry is brought to 0.001 to 1 wt%. Step (2): The slurry obtained in step (1) is applied on a carrier. Step (3): The dispersion medium is removed from the carrier onto which the slurry obtained in step (2) had been applied, and a humidity control member including the silica porous body and the carrier is obtained.
